Catholic bishops and religious call for action as report shows world’s biggest banks hugely increase fossil fuel financing in 2024
The world’s top 65 banks have financed fossil fuels with $7.9 trillion since the Paris Agreement, according to the latest edition of the Banking on Climate Chaos report. Big banks poured $869 billion into fossil fuels in 2024 alone, with two thirds of banks...
